Guri Guri is a delicious frozen treat. Sort of like a sorbet but creamier. It can only be found at the Tasaka Guri Guri shop on Maui. The Tasaka family has been serving up this delicious treat on the island for many years. Their recipe is top-secret, however I came up with my own recipe that\’s pretty close. It only comes in 2 flavors, Strawberry & Pineapple; however this recipe tastes great with other flavors of fruit sodas.

Ingredients
  

  • 40 oz of Fanta Strawberry or Pineapple soda
  • 1 14 oz can of Sweetened Condensed Milk

Instructions
 

  • Loosen the cap of the soda to let the carbonation out. You’ll want your soda to be flat. I usually let the soda sit for about a day.
  • In a bowl mix the soda and milk together. Refrigerate the mixture until it is cold.
  • Pour the mixture into an ice cream maker.
  • If you don’t have an ice cream maker, you can just put the mixture in the freezer, however it will be a slushy consistency instead of creamy.
